Relative Search:
Baidu Google
Edit this listing

Teledex Downlink Satellite Tv

7477 Elk River Rd
Eureka , CA 95503
707-442-2782

Driving Directions

From:
To: 7477 Elk River Rd ,Eureka , CA 95503